In one of the most highly anticipated episodes this season, SNLs own Will Ferrell comes home to host a new Saturday Night Live tonight!
Will Ferrell has to be towards the top of any list of Saturday Night Live cast members who went on to meet post-show success. Tonight at 11:30pm on NBC, Will returns to Studio 8-H where he spent 7 seasons (1995 2002) as a part of SNL to host the show for a fourth time. His last time hosting SNL was May, 2012, so its been awhile since this one of Saturday Night Lives favorite sons has been back to helm the show. However, in a season filled with so many first-time hosts, Ferrell definitely wont have to be caught up to speed on how the live series works.
A lot of tonights fun is going to be watching to see how many of Will Ferrells classic SNL characters are revisited and also how many cameo performances are added to tonights show to highlight the hosts return to the variety series. Tonight, the cold open seems like a perfect and obvious choice for Will Ferrells critically acclaimed and Emmy award-nominated impersonation of President George W. Bush. If Alec Baldwin can be lured back to SNL, (he hasnt had an appearance portraying President Donald Trump since the December 16, 2017 episode), it would be a great meeting of Presidential impressions, with Ferrells W arriving in the Oval Office to gloat about having higher approval ratings than Trump, despite leaving the White House with near-record low popularity.
Other familiar Will Ferrell characters and impressions that would cause a pop with the live audience, viewers at home and on social media, include the late singer Robert Goulet, TV therapist Dr. Phil, the Dad who demands respect for driving a Dodge Stratus, James Lipton from Inside the Actors Studio, and Weekend Update favorites- late baseball commentator Harry Caray and Jacob Silj who cant control the volume of his voice due to Voice Immodulation Syndrome. And of course, we could almost guarantee Ferrell hosting a round of the classic SNL sketch, Celebrity Jeopardy! as the frustrated Alex Trebeck who must deal with clueless celebrity players, including fellow SNL alumnus Darrell Hammonds abusive Sean Connery.
